原文:Hive不同文件的读取与序列化

Hive不同文件的读取对照 stored as textfile 直接查看hdfs hadoop fs text hive gt create table test txt name string,val string stored as textfile stored as sequencefile hadoop fs text hive gt create table test seq na ...

2017-06-24 18:42 0 1182 推荐指数:

查看详情

Hive序列化与反序列化(SerDe)

序列化与反序列化的作用 1,序列化是对象转化为字节序列的过程; 2,反序列化是字节码恢复为对象的过程; 序列化的作用主要有两个: (1),对象向的持久;即把对象转换成字节码后保存文件; (2),对象数据的传输; 反序列化的主要作用: 对<key,value>反序列化 ...

Fri May 11 21:33:00 CST 2018 0 4512
文件和流(序列化

可以借助另一项技术把数据保存到文件--序列化序列化是一个基于 .NET 流的高层模型。就本质而言,序列化允许你把整个活动的对象转换为一系列字节,并把这些字节写入 FileStream 之类的流对象中。以后,你可以重新读取这些字节从而重建原对象。 你的类必须符合下列 ...

Tue Aug 21 18:56:00 CST 2012 0 3306
文件序列化和反序列化

工作中我们经常会用到序列化和反序列化,主要用于进行文件读取和保存,能够更好的保存我们项目中所进行使用的东西: 在日常生活中我们有许多文件都是通过二进制的方式进行存储,但是二进制的文件的制作需要首先进行序列化: 关于序列化的目的: 1、以某种存储形式使自定义对象持久; 2、将对象从一 ...

Thu May 30 07:32:00 CST 2019 0 916
序列化流 把对象以指定的格式写入到文件中保存和读取

序列化流 java提供了一种对象序列化的机制,用一个字节序列可以表示一个对象,该字节序列包含该对象的数据,对象的类型和对象中存储的属性等信息,字节序列写入到文件中后,就相当于在文件中保存了文件对象信息. 反之,该字节序列还可以从文件读取出来,重构对象.对他进行反序列化.对象的数据,对象的类型 ...

Wed Dec 23 06:39:00 CST 2020 0 410
Hive中自定义序列化器(带编码)

hive SerDe的简介 https://www.jianshu.com/p/afee9acba686 问题 数据文件为文本文件,每一行为固定格式,每一列的长度都是定长或是有限制范围,考虑采用hive提供的RegexSerDe来实现记录解析,使用后发现hive查询出的数据中文字段乱码 ...

Fri Sep 18 21:58:00 CST 2020 0 738
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M